100% Drop-In Compatibility: Zero Installation Hassles

Time is money during a maintenance shutdown. Our pump guarantees 100% dimensional interchangeability with the Griswold 811 ANSI Series. Flange-to-flange dimensions, centerline heights, and baseplate footprints match the original specifications exactly, complying with ASME B73.1 standards. This true drop-in design ensures that your maintenance team can swap out the old pump without modifying existing pipelines, foundations, or motor mounts, drastically reducing installation time and labor costs.
Upgraded Reliability: Precision Engineering and Testing
We do not just copy, we improve. Our ANSI B73.1 equivalent features enhanced structural reliability. The pump body and cover are reinforced with optimized ribs, validated through advanced mechanical analysis to handle demanding industrial loads. Every pump is rigorously hydrostatically tested according to ASME B73.1 and HI 14.6 standards to ensure absolute leak-free performance. Furthermore, the rotor undergoes API 610 Class 2.5 dynamic balancing, which minimizes shaft deflection, reduces bearing wear, and significantly extends the Mean Time Between Failures (MTBF).
Broad Hydraulic Coverage and Material Flexibility
Matching the versatile nature of the Griswold 811, our pump is available in multiple frame sizes and a wide array of metallurgies, including Ductile Iron, 316 Stainless Steel, and CD4MCu. Whether you are handling clean water, corrosive chemicals, or abrasive slurries, we have the right material configuration. We also offer customized sealing and lubrication options, with remote monitoring interfaces available for modern predictive maintenance strategies.
